基础概念
更改对象的颜色是指通过编程或设计手段修改图形、文本或其他视觉元素的颜色属性。这在用户界面设计、数据可视化、游戏开发等领域中非常常见。
相关优势
- 增强视觉效果:通过改变颜色可以吸引用户的注意力,增强界面的吸引力。
- 信息传达:颜色可以用来传达特定的信息或情感,例如红色通常表示警告或危险,绿色表示安全或成功。
- 个性化:用户可以根据自己的喜好选择不同的颜色主题,提升用户体验。
类型
- 静态颜色更改:在应用程序启动时或设计阶段预设的颜色更改。
- 动态颜色更改:根据用户操作、时间变化或其他条件实时改变颜色。
应用场景
- 用户界面设计:按钮、图标、背景等元素的颜色调整。
- 数据可视化:图表、地图等数据展示元素的颜色调整,以便更好地区分和理解数据。
- 游戏开发:角色、场景、道具等元素的颜色调整,增强游戏的视觉效果和沉浸感。
常见问题及解决方法
问题:为什么更改对象颜色时,颜色显示不正确?
原因:
- 颜色代码错误:使用的颜色代码(如十六进制、RGB等)不正确。
- 渲染问题:浏览器或渲染引擎可能存在bug,导致颜色显示不正确。
- 兼容性问题:不同设备或浏览器可能对颜色的渲染存在差异。
解决方法:
- 检查颜色代码:确保使用的颜色代码正确无误。
- 检查颜色代码:确保使用的颜色代码正确无误。
- 更新浏览器或引擎:确保使用的浏览器或渲染引擎是最新版本。
- 测试兼容性:在不同设备和浏览器上测试颜色显示效果,确保兼容性。
问题:如何实现动态颜色更改?
解决方法:
- 使用JavaScript:通过JavaScript监听用户操作或其他事件,实时更改颜色。
- 使用JavaScript:通过JavaScript监听用户操作或其他事件,实时更改颜色。
- 使用CSS变量:通过CSS变量实现动态颜色更改。
- 使用CSS变量:通过CSS变量实现动态颜色更改。
- 使用CSS变量:通过CSS变量实现动态颜色更改。
参考链接
通过以上方法,你可以有效地更改对象的颜色,并解决常见的颜色显示问题。